Griddle, Girdle s. a gridiron
Gripe, or Grip s. a small drain or ditch v. to cut into gripes
Grizzle v. to laugh or grin
Gronin s. labour, childbirth; Gronin-chair nursing chair; Gronin-malt provision for the event
Ground s. a field, a piece of land enclosed for agricultural purposes
Grozens, Groves s. duck-weed
Gruff, Gruff-hole s. a trench or groove excavated for ore
Gruffer, Gruffler s. a miner, one who works in a gruff or groove
Gumpy adj. abounding in protuberances
Gurds s. eructations; Fits and Gurds fits and starts
